Clément Falaise is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Inorganic Chemistry and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Clément Falaise has authored 64 papers receiving a total of 1.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 60 papers in Materials Chemistry, 56 papers in Inorganic Chemistry and 12 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Clément Falaise’s work include Polyoxometalates: Synthesis and Applications (39 papers),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(36 papers) and Radioactive element chemistry and processing (24 papers). Clément Falaise is often cited by papers focused on Polyoxometalates: Synthesis and Applications (39 papers),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(36 papers) and Radioactive element chemistry and processing (24 papers). Clément Falaise collaborates with scholars based in France, Russia and United States. Clément Falaise's co-authors include Thierry Loiseau, Christophe Volkringer, Emmanuel Cadot, Mohamed Haouas and May Nyman and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Chemical Communications.
